Full-length curtains typically extend from the top of the window to the floor, creating a dramatic and sophisticated effect. The standard height for full-length curtains usually ranges from 84 to 108 inches, depending on the ceiling height and the style you’re aiming for. It’s important to note that the correct drop not only enhances your room’s design but also optimizes light control and privacy.

The ideal length typically ranges from 84 to 108 inches, depending on your ceiling height and desired style.
If your curtains bunch up excessively on the floor or cover your baseboards, they may be too long. A slight puddle is usually acceptable, but too much can look messy.
Yes! Full-length curtains can actually help create the illusion of height, making small rooms feel larger. Just ensure they are hung correctly to maximize this effect.
Regularly dust and vacuum your curtains, and follow the manufacturer’s cleaning instructions. Some fabrics may be machine washable, while others may require professional cleaning.
Yes, curtains are usually lighter and less formal, while drapes tend to be heavier and more structured, often lined for added privacy and insulation.
